Several elements are shaping the Cryogenic Capsules Industry's trajectory. The rising demand for medical applications, particularly in biobanking, has necessitated effective storage solutions to ensure the integrity of sensitive biological materials. The polypropylene segment is a key player in this market, as its properties make it ideal for manufacturing durable cryogenic capsules. On the other hand, the growing popularity of polyethylene showcases the industry's versatility and responsiveness to market needs. Despite challenges, including stringent regulations and high operational costs, the overall outlook remains positive, with innovation driving sustained growth.
Regionally, the Cryogenic Capsules Industry is seeing divergent trends. North America remains a stronghold, largely due to the mature healthcare infrastructure and significant R&D investments. However, the Asia-Pacific region is emerging rapidly, exhibiting the fastest growth as nations like China and India amplify their healthcare investments. This shift presents an opportunity for industry players to expand into these burgeoning markets, capturing a share of the increasing demand for cryogenic solutions.
